2020-08-11 01:16:53 +03:00
|
|
|
import { BarTask } from "../types/bar-task";
|
|
|
|
|
import { Task } from "../types/public-types";
|
|
|
|
|
|
2020-08-09 10:51:25 +03:00
|
|
|
export function isKeyboardEvent(
|
|
|
|
|
event: React.MouseEvent | React.KeyboardEvent
|
|
|
|
|
): event is React.KeyboardEvent {
|
|
|
|
|
return (event as React.KeyboardEvent).key !== undefined;
|
|
|
|
|
}
|
2020-08-11 01:16:53 +03:00
|
|
|
|
|
|
|
|
export function isBarTask(task: Task | BarTask): task is BarTask {
|
|
|
|
|
return (task as BarTask).x1 !== undefined;
|
|
|
|
|
}
|